Sick DFS60B-TEPC10000 - Incremental Encoder

Sick DFS60B-TEPC10000 incremental encoder provides 10,000 pulses per revolution, TTL/HTL output, through hollow shaft, and 600 kHz frequency capability. This Sick Sick Encoder supports 4.5–32 V supply voltage, 6-channel signals, M12 8-pin connector, ≤ 6,000 min⁻¹ operating speed, aluminum die-cast housing, stainless steel 12 mm hollow shaft, and –40 °C to +100 °C operating temperature range.

Sick DFS60B-TEPC10000 Incremental Encoder - Technical Specifications

SpecificationValue
Pulses per revolution10,000 1)
Measuring step90°, electric/pulses per revolution
Error limits± 0.05°
Communication interfaceIncremental
Communication Interface detailTTL / HTL
Factory settingFactory setting: output level TTL
Number of signal channels6-channel
Initialization time32 ms, 30 ms 1)
Output frequency≤ 600 kHz
Load current≤ 30 mA
Power consumption≤ 0.7 W (without load)
Connection typeMale connector, M12, 8-pin, radial
Supply voltage4.5 ... 32 V
Mechanical designThrough hollow shaft
Shaft diameter12 mm
Shaft materialStainless steel
Flange materialAluminum
Housing materialAluminum die cast
Start up torque0.8 Ncm (+20 °C)
Operating torque0.6 Ncm (+20 °C)
Operating speed≤ 6,000 min⁻¹ 1)
Moment of inertia of the rotor40 gcm²
Bearing lifetime3.6 x 10^10 revolutions
Angular acceleration≤ 500,000 rad/s²
Operating temperature range–40 °C ... +100 °C 2)–30 °C ... +100 °C 3)
Storage temperature range–40 °C ... +100 °C, without package

The DFS60B-TEPC10000 incremental encoder is a Sick encoder designed for rotational speed and position feedback in industrial automation systems. This DFS60B-TEPC10000 incremental encoder delivers 10,000 pulses per revolution, TTL/HTL incremental interface, and a through hollow shaft design for direct shaft mounting. Operating with ≤ 600 kHz output frequency and a 4.5–32 V DC supply, it belongs to the DFS60 series and is widely used in encoder-based motion control applications.

The DFS60B-TEPC10000 incremental encoder is applied in conveyors, packaging machinery, automated assembly lines, and material handling systems. Its stable incremental signals support accurate speed monitoring and position tracking of rotating components. The through hollow shaft construction simplifies mechanical integration, while the connector-based electrical interface ensures consistent signal transmission during continuous industrial operation.

The Sick DFS60B-TEPC10000 incremental encoder combines defined electrical performance with durable mechanical construction. With controlled torque values, long bearing lifetime, and aluminum housing, this incremental encoder supports dependable operation under industrial conditions. As part of the DFS60 series from Sick, the DFS60B-TEPC10000 incremental encoder is suitable for automation systems requiring repeatable rotational measurement and long-term operational reliability.
